Shopify Inc., Elliott Wave Technical Analysis

Shopify Inc., (SHOP:NYSE): Daily Chart, August 16, 2022, 
SHOPStock Market Analysis: Looking for continuation lower into wave {v}. Potential wave {iv} is taking quite some time which could have been predicted due to the fact that wave {ii} was a sharp correction therefore because of the rule of alternation wave {iv} had to be time consuming.

SHOP Elliott Wave count:  Wave (c of {iv}.
SHOPTrading Strategy: Waiting for further confirmation to start building shorts. We need to break wave iv of (c.

SHOPTechnical Indicators:We are well below the 200 EMA and we are starting to form RSI bearish divergence.
